Transaction 3a657ccec50cdc2308a449d541310637bd91610f487a6ed86a8234c6f3997740

2 Input
2 Outputs
  • 3a657ccec50cdc2308a449d541310637bd91610f487a6ed86a8234c6f3997740:0
  • value  1980100000
    address  17rse8fwo51Sbnj5Uk6hrtof53TJ6zdqW4
  • 3a657ccec50cdc2308a449d541310637bd91610f487a6ed86a8234c6f3997740:1
  • value  2107113897
    address  1FFZubjifpGdgd5o8DUpfthFYjmrCMPPEd